Bruno Guimaraes is reportedly keen on leaving Newcastle United this summer, setting his sights on a move to Arsenal. The midfielder aims for a transfer that would secure a “high fee” for Newcastle, with Arsenal suggested to be preparing an offer around £60 million to facilitate the deal.
According to Football365, The Athletic’s David Ornstein reported that Guimaraes has indicated a desire to depart, with personal terms already verbally agreed with Arsenal. However, no formal club-to-club contact has taken place as yet, and Newcastle maintains that their captain is not available for transfer.
Guimaraes Pushes for Arsenal Move
Keith Downie from Sky Sports indicated that Guimaraes is advocating for a move to Arsenal, citing a need for Newcastle to receive a substantial fee. Reports suggest that Newcastle is surprised by Arsenal’s lack of direct contact regarding the player, with discussions primarily being routed through agents.
Newcastle’s Reluctance to Sell
While Guimaraes reportedly wants the move, Newcastle is said to be firm in their stance of not wanting to sell their star player. The Magpies are reportedly seeking a sum close to £102 million to consider parting with him, adding complexity to Arsenal’s pursuit, even as the Gunners prepare to make a formal bid.
Footballing Decision Over Financial Gain
Recent insights suggest that Guimaraes’s motivations are largely football-related rather than financial. As Newcastle’s highest earner, he is likely to receive comparable wages at Arsenal. His drive to win trophies at 29 years old is shaping his desire to move, creating an intriguing storyline as the summer transfer window continues.
